Description

Cholesteryl-Teg azide is a cholesterol azide and can be used as a ligand for bioconjugation. Cholesteryl-Teg azide can modify RNA strands[1].

Molecular Weight

630.90

Formula

C36H62N4O5

CAS No.
Unlabeled CAS

Appearance

Oil

SMILES

C[C@@]12[C@]3([H])[C@](CC=C1C[C@H](CC2)OC(NCCOCCOCCOCCN=[N+]=[N-])=O)([H])[C@@]4([H])[C@](CC3)([C@@](CC4)([H])[C@H](C)CCCC(C)C)C

Shipping

Room temperature in continental US; may vary elsewhere.

Storage
Pure form -20°C 3 years
In solvent -80°C 6 months
-20°C 1 month
Solvent & Solubility
In Vitro: 

DMSO : 33.33 mg/mL (52.83 mM; ultrasonic and warming and heat to 60°C; Hygroscopic DMSO has a significant impact on the solubility of product, please use newly opened DMSO)
